The Feedstock-Conversion Interface Consortium (FCIC) is developing fundamental understanding, tools, and strategies about construction materials to predict and address equipment wear.

Objectives

FCIC’s research objectives include:

  • Gaining a fundamental understanding of failure modes and wear mechanisms
  • Developing analytical tools/models to predict wear and establish material property specifications
  • Identifying and demonstrating cost-effective mitigation strategies.

FCIC researchers recently developed an analytical model to predict the edge recession in knife-mill blades based on the chemical, physical, and mechanic properties of the knife-mill blades. Being able to predict how biomass properties will affect the lifetime of processing hardware helps process engineers make better decisions about capital purchases and preventive maintenance intervals.
